Development and Analysis of 3D Printed Knee Orthosis for Post Anterior Cruciate Ligament Injuries Rehabilitation
An anterior cruciate ligament (ACL) rupture is one of the most severe injuries an athlete can suffer, resulting in knee joint instability and significant pain. This study aims to develop and analyze 3D-printed knee orthoses for post-ACL injury rehabilitation to overcome conventional orthoses' d...
